DFW Airport Hotel & Conference Center sells fast on our site. This Irving hotel is a 10-minute drive from the Dallas/Fort Worth Airport and offers a free shuttle. The hotel also features a miniature golf course and rooms with free Wi-Fi.
Every room at the DFW Airport Hotel is equipped with ironing facilities and a coffee maker. The spacious rooms include cable TV. A microwave and fridge are available upon request.
Guests at the Hotel DFW Airport have free access to the indoor pool, hot tub and the gym. A 24-hour business center and laundry facilities are also featured.
Six Flags Over Texas and Texas Stadium are a 15-minute drive from the Irving Hotel and Conference Center near DFW Airport. The C.R. Smith Aviation Museum is 5 minutes away.
